Description

Robots have entered into many aspects of human life,
including medical science. The impact of robotics on medicine
is undeniable. Robots can be defined as "automatically
controlled multitask manipulators, which are freely
programmable in three or more axes." The success of robots is
based on their precision, lack of fatigue, and speed of action.
Medical robotics is a promising field that really took off in the
1990s. Since then, a wide variety of medical applications have
emerged: laboratory robots, surgical training, remote surgery,
telemedicine and teleconsultation, rehabilitation and hospital
robots. There are, however, many challenges in the widespread
implementation of robotics in the medical field, mainly due to
issues such as safety, precision, cost and reluctance to accept
this technology. Medical robotics includes a number of
devices used for surgery, medical training, rehabilitation
therapy, prosthetics, and assistance to people with disabilities.
Robotic surgery has been successfully implemented in several
hospitals around the globe and has received world wide
acceptance. This paper provides an overview of the impact of
robots in multiple medical domains, which is one of the most
active areas for research and development of robots.
